Add 98/42 and 2/5
1st number: 2 14/42, 2nd number: 2/5
98/42 + 2/5 is 41/15.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 42 and 5 is 210
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 210 - For the 1st fraction, since 42 × 5 = 210,
98/42 = 98 × 5/42 × 5 = 490/210 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 5 × 42 = 210,
2/5 = 2 × 42/5 × 42 = 84/210 - Add the two like fractions:
490/210 + 84/210 = 490 + 84/210 = 574/210 - 574/210 simplified gives 41/15
- So, 98/42 + 2/5 = 41/15
